The stage for "Rock Lobster" is a tribute to the series' history. It begins in an aqua environment but quickly transitions through a "comic book" style montage of backgrounds from previous Just Dance tracks, such as "Apache (Jump On It)" and "Jump In The Line". The routine culminates in an underwater scene at the "ocean floor". Special Gameplay Features
